Actor Dmitry Kharatyan said on the Good Morning program that the current US President Donald Trump asked director Leonid Gaidai for a small role in a movie.
We are talking about the movie “It’s nice weather on Deribasovskaya, or it’s raining again on Brighton Beach.” Trump allowed the film to be filmed for free at the Taj Mahal casino in Atlantic City. For this, Gaidai thanked the businessman on loan. Trump, through an assistant, asked him to appear in the film, albeit non-verbally, but the director refused.
“Gaidai answered him: “Who is this? I don’t know such an artist. I have People’s Artists of the Soviet Union! Myagkov, Kuravlev, Dzhigarkhanyan. Donald Trump, who is this? But in vain. I think we can use this now!” — the artist shared.
Donald Trump has made cameo appearances many times in various movies. One of its most famous episodes was featured in Chris Columbus’s film Home Alone 2: Lost in New York. His on-screen appearance lasts about 10 seconds – he showed the main character, played by Macaulay Culkin, how to get to the hotel lobby.
